6.Using the angle measurements given, name and classify the figure. Explain how you
know.
140
, 20
, 20
_isosceles____
_obtuse_______
__triangle______
(by sides)
(by angles)
(polygon)
It is isosceles because there are two angles (sides) that are equal
It is obtuse because there is one angle that measures more than 90 degrees
It is a triangle because it has 3 angles
7. Without using a protractor, find the value of angle x?
114 degrees
x
33
33
33 degrees + 33 degrees = 66 degrees.
180 degrees – 66 degrees = 114 degrees.
